Everything You Need To Know About Linear Rod Actuators

linear rod actuators are a type of linear actuator that is commonly used in various industries and applications. These devices are designed to convert rotary motion into linear motion, making them ideal for applications that require precise and controlled linear movement. In this article, we will explore what linear rod actuators are, how they work, their applications, and the benefits they offer.

A linear rod actuator consists of a rod attached to a piston inside a cylinder. When pressure is applied to the piston, it moves the rod in a linear direction, creating linear motion. The movement of the rod can be controlled and adjusted to meet the specific requirements of the application.

linear rod actuators work by utilizing a rotary motor to drive a lead screw or ball screw, which is connected to the rod. As the screw rotates, it moves the rod in a linear direction. The speed and distance of the rod’s movement can be controlled by adjusting the speed and direction of the motor.

linear rod actuators are widely used in various applications across different industries. One common application is in automated manufacturing processes, where precise linear movement is required to ensure accurate assembly and production. Linear rod actuators are also used in robotics, medical devices, aerospace, and automotive industries.

One of the key benefits of linear rod actuators is their ability to provide precise and controlled linear motion. This makes them ideal for applications that require accurate positioning and repetitive movements. Linear rod actuators are also known for their reliability and durability, making them a popular choice for industrial applications.

Another advantage of linear rod actuators is their versatility. They can be customized to meet the specific requirements of the application, such as speed, stroke length, and load capacity. This flexibility makes linear rod actuators suitable for a wide range of applications across different industries.

Linear rod actuators are also known for their compact design, which makes them easy to integrate into existing systems. They are typically lightweight and require minimal maintenance, making them a cost-effective solution for many applications. Linear rod actuators are also energy-efficient, as they only consume power when in operation.
